Both cardio and strength training have the capability to help you burn calories, boost your metabolism, and maintain a healthy weight, but they do it in different ways. Cardio helps you burn calories and, at certain intensities, fat stores, while you work out. Some people like to do their cardio right before their weight training. If you only have one hour a day to hit the gym and exercise, this seems pretty reasonable. But if your goal is to see big increases in your strength training or overall endurance, you'll be disappointed. The scientists focused on 19 studies where participants performed strength and cardio during the same workout and analyzed VO2 max and lower-body strength. The studies lasted from 8 to 24 weeks, and the people exercised two to three times per week.

Cardio is important for overall heart health, cardiovascular endurance, and burning excess calories. Too much cardio can lead to a weight loss plateau or overtraining. Strength training is important to build muscle, increase metabolism, and help you get results faster than just cardio alone.

Resistance exercise done before aerobic exercise results in a small increase in lower-body muscular strength without compromising all the other improvements in health-related physical fitness. Baar says: “This might limit muscle growth, but will increase endurance signals.”.People always ask which is better to do first when working out…cardio or strength? Some say that one way burns more fat, while the other optimizes muscle growth. There is no conclusive evidence to show that one way is better than the other. That being said, starting your workout with light cardio for about five minutes is a good way to start.
